Job Description:
The Business Development Manager maintains the business development relationship with attorneys in the Health & Life Sciences practice group, while driving collaboration across other practice areas as it relates to core initiatives. This position develops and implements business development strategies in order to expand client relationships, increase revenue and brand recognition, while overseeing business development team members and departmental processes. The Business Development Manager relies on extensive experience and judgment to plan and accomplish practice group goals and foster cross-practice initiatives.
Essential Functions and Responsibilities:
- Organize and drive client targeting programs and campaigns for supported areas, including prompting and monitoring pursuit activities, and tracking and reporting on results
- Lead and draft content for RFPs, pitches and other opportunities, including coordinating with other business development team members, conducting follow up and tracking results in Salesforce
- Identify and facilitate cross-selling opportunities within the designated practice group and other firm practice groups, including crafting and executing a range of go-to-market strategies around these opportunities and collaborating with other BD team members
- Oversee the strategic planning and execution of Signature McDermott events, maximizing engagement and business impact.
- Serve as lead point person for practice and firm-wide events, overseeing content, targeting, speaker engagement, event logistics, and follow-up reporting
- Monitor industry trends and conduct strategic research on potential clients, competitors and practice developments to identify business and legal opportunities and ensure optimal positioning to grow market share
- Identify and facilitate participation in sponsorships, conferences, memberships and other key profile-building opportunities for the practice, office and individual lawyers
- Drive collaboration within BD department and firm teams and resources, identifying and leveraging synergistic opportunities to enhance service offerings
- Guide lateral hires through the integration process, aligning them with firm priorities and monitoring milestones
- Manage assigned legal directory and league ranking submissions, and assist the awards team in the generation of matters and other information for awards submissions
- Direct and support business development team members through project workflows, monitoring performance and providing regular constructive feedback, while also contributing to the annual staff performance evaluation processes.
- Manage, review and track the business development budget for the designated practice group
- Consult with attorneys to develop and monitor individual business development goals and plans
- Review and regularly update collateral and experience for the designated practice group, including practice-wide communications, brochures, and presentations
